3. Check for Hidden or Additional Costs
One common pitfall when booking a self drive car rental in delhi india, is failing to account for hidden or additional costs. While the base rent of the car may seem affordable, there are often extra fees that can add up quickly. Some of these include charges for insurance, a security deposit, fuel, and even damages or penalties for speeding. Make sure you read the fine print of the rental agreement, paying particular attention to clauses about insurance, damages, and other liabilities.
Additionally, check the terms and conditions related to mileage limits. Some self-drive car rentals may charge extra fees if you exceed a certain number of kilometers during your trip. It's also important to ask about the refundable security deposit, as some companies may withhold a portion of it in case of damages or fines. Clarifying these fees upfront will help you avoid unexpected costs and ensure that the price you pay matches your expectations.
4. Inspect the Car Thoroughly Before Rental
Inspect the self-drive car thoroughly for damages before signing the rental agreement and driving off.
Use your smartphone to take photos or videos of the car from different angles. This evidence can protect you if there are any disputes about damages after your rental period ends. In addition to inspecting the body of the car, check the oil level, tire pressure, lights, and other essential components to ensure that the vehicle is in good working condition. Confirm that the car has a spare tire, a stepney jack, and other emergency tools in case of a breakdown. If you notice any issues or concerns, make sure they are addressed before finalizing the booking.
5. Have All the Necessary Documents Ready
When renting a self drive car rental in delhi india, there are several important documents that you'll need to provide. Ensure you have all the required paperwork in place before booking the car. The following documents are typically necessary:
Valid Driver’s License: You must have a valid Indian or international driver’s license to rent a self-drive car.
Aadhar Card or PAN Card: Some rental agencies may require proof of identity and residence.
Rental Agreement: Always read the rental agreement carefully before signing it. Make sure all terms and conditions are clear, especially regarding mileage limits, insurance, and damages.
Insurance: Ensure that the car rental includes third-party insurance at a minimum, and inquire about additional coverage for accidents or theft.
Registration Certificate (RC): This document proves that the vehicle is legally registered.
PUC (Pollution Under Control) Certificate: This is a legally required certification for all automobiles in India.
Make sure to carry these documents with you during your trip, as you may need to show them in case of any road checks or emergencies. If the rental agency doesn't provide any of these documents, request a copy for your records.
6. Verify the Fuel Policy
Before taking possession of your rental car, it’s important to clarify the fuel policy. Most self drive car rental in delhi india, will give you the car with a full tank of fuel and expect you to return it in the same condition. If this is the case, make sure to top up the fuel before returning the car to avoid extra charges. However, some agencies may provide the car with a partial tank and ask you to return it with the same amount of fuel. In such cases, clarify the exact fuel requirements to avoid misunderstandings.
Additionally, make sure to check whether the rental company charges extra for fuel if you fail to return the car with the required fuel level. Being aware of the fuel policy can help you save money and avoid unnecessary stress.
